/***** site *****/
body#pagina-externa {
    width: 100% !important;
    background:#FFF !important;
    font-size: 14px;
}
/* non-responsive */
body#pagina-externa .form-control {}
body#pagina-externa .col-sm-1, body#pagina-externa .col-sm-2, body#pagina-externa .col-sm-3, body#pagina-externa .col-sm-4, body#pagina-externa .col-sm-5, body#pagina-externa .col-sm-6, body#pagina-externa .col-sm-7, body#pagina-externa .col-sm-8, body#pagina-externa .col-sm-9, body#pagina-externa .col-sm-10, body#pagina-externa .col-sm-11, body#pagina-externa .col-sm-12 {
    float: left
}

body#pagina-externa .col-sm-12 {width: 100%}
body#pagina-externa .col-sm-11 {width: 91.66666666666666%}
body#pagina-externa .col-sm-10 {width: 83.33333333333334%}
body#pagina-externa .col-sm-9 {width: 75%}
body#pagina-externa .col-sm-8 {width: 66.66666666666666%}
body#pagina-externa .col-sm-7 {width: 58.333333333333336%}
body#pagina-externa .col-sm-6 {width: 50%}
body#pagina-externa .col-sm-5 {width: 41.66666666666667%}
body#pagina-externa .col-sm-4 {width: 33.33333333333333%}
body#pagina-externa .col-sm-3 {width: 25%}
body#pagina-externa .col-sm-2 {width: 16.666666666666664%}
body#pagina-externa .col-sm-1 {width: 8.333333333333332%}
body#pagina-externa .container {
    margin:0 !important;padding: 0 !important;
}

body#pagina-externa h1 {
    font-weight: bold !important;
    font-size: 18px;
    color:#145F4C;
    margin-bottom:22px;
}
body#pagina-externa h2,
body#pagina-externa h2 small {
    font-size: 16px;
    color:#0B8543;
    padding-bottom:5px;
    margin:0 0 20px;
}
body#pagina-externa h2 {
    font-weight:bold !important;
    border-bottom:1px solid #CBD0D4;
}
body#pagina-externa h3 {
    font-weight:bold !important;
    font-size: 16px;
    color: #666666;
}
body#pagina-externa .form-site {
    width:100%;
}
body#pagina-externa .well {
    /*padding: 0 19px 19px 19px !important;*/
    background:#F2F2F2 !important;
    border:1px solid #CCC !important;
    -webkit-border-radius:10px !important;
    -moz-border-radius:10px !important;
    border-radius:10px !important;
    display: table;
}

body#pagina-externa .idicador-identidade {
    padding:0 0 50px;
}
body#pagina-externa .alert {
    -webkit-border-radius:5px !important;
    -moz-border-radius:5px !important;
    border-radius:5px !important;
}
body#pagina-externa .alert h3 {color: inherit;border-bottom: 1px solid;}
body#pagina-externa .alert a {color: inherit;}
body#pagina-externa .alert-success { border-color: #BEDDA6;background:#DFF0D8;}
body#pagina-externa .alert-info { border-color: #97DBEA;background:#D9EDF7; }
body#pagina-externa .alert-warning { border-color: #CDC7BF;background:#FAF2CB; }
body#pagina-externa .alert-danger { border-color: #EBCCD1;background:#F2DEDE; }

body#pagina-externa #identidade {
    margin-top:-8px;
    width:302px;
    position: absolute;
    right:0;
}
body#pagina-externa .mensagem-identidade {}

body#pagina-externa .form-body {padding:0;margin:0;background:none !important;}
body#pagina-externa .form-body .control-label {padding-left:0;padding-right:0;text-align:right;}
body#pagina-externa .form-solicitacao .control-label.col-sm-2 {width:140px !important;}

body#pagina-externa .form-group.form-group-rg-dv {/*position:absolute;margin:-30px 0 0 313px;*/}
body#pagina-externa .form-group.form-group-rg-dv input {width:30px;}


body#pagina-externa .form-group .no-width {width: auto !important;}

body#pagina-externa .form-group .help-block {margin-bottom:5px;}

body#pagina-externa .form-actions {margin-top:0px;border:none;}
body#pagina-externa .alert .form-actions {margin-top:0;background: none;}

/*body#pagina-externa label.active {
    color:#D96D00;
    font-weight: bold;
}
body#pagina-externa input.active {
    border:2px solid #D96D00;
}*/
body#pagina-externa .help-block {clear:both;}

body#pagina-externa .help-block { font-size: 0.857em }

body#pagina-externa .ui-icon, .ui-widget-content .ui-icon {
    background-image: url("/packages/celepar/light/assets/css/images/ui-icons_888888_256x240.png");
}

.nopadding {padding:0 !important;}

div.acoes {
    text-align: center;
    margin-top: 10px;
    border-top: 1px solid #cbd0d4;
    padding-top: 15px;
}

.form-site .secao {
    margin-bottom: 20px;
}

.form-inline .form-group {
    display: inline-block;
    margin-bottom: 0;
    vertical-align: middle;
}

.col-md-9 .form-group {
    margin: 0 !important;
}

.title {
    color: #0b8543;
    font-size: 16px;
    margin: 0 0 20px;
    padding-bottom: 5px;
    font-weight: bold !important;
    line-height: 30px;
}

div.panel-footer.warning {
    background: #faf2cb none repeat scroll 0 0 !important;
    color: #8a6d3b !important;;
}

div.titulo {
    margin-bottom: 20px;
    font-size: 15px;
    font-weight: bold;
    background-color: #d5d5d5;
    line-height: 50px;
    border: 1px solid #e0dfe3;;
    text-align: center;
}

.container-fluid .secao h2 {
    color: #0b8543;
    font-size: 20px;
    font-weight: bold !important;
    padding-bottom: 5px;
    border-bottom: 1px solid #cbd0d4;
}